diff options
8 files changed, 24 insertions, 0 deletions
diff --git a/source/blender/blenloader/intern/readfile.c b/source/blender/blenloader/intern/readfile.c index b9ba17d1120..9c220e59017 100644 --- a/source/blender/blenloader/intern/readfile.c +++ b/source/blender/blenloader/intern/readfile.c @@ -159,6 +159,9 @@ #include <errno.h> +/* Make preferences read-only. */ +#define U (*((const UserDef *)&U)) + /** * READ * ==== diff --git a/source/blender/blenloader/intern/versioning_250.c b/source/blender/blenloader/intern/versioning_250.c index d8e4f3d97a5..3e7b1582603 100644 --- a/source/blender/blenloader/intern/versioning_250.c +++ b/source/blender/blenloader/intern/versioning_250.c @@ -84,6 +84,9 @@ #include <errno.h> +/* Make preferences read-only, use versioning_userdef.c. */ +#define U (*((const UserDef *)&U)) + /* 2.50 patch */ static void area_add_header_region(ScrArea *sa, ListBase *lb) { diff --git a/source/blender/blenloader/intern/versioning_260.c b/source/blender/blenloader/intern/versioning_260.c index 4e0be8ceb9c..40219a36323 100644 --- a/source/blender/blenloader/intern/versioning_260.c +++ b/source/blender/blenloader/intern/versioning_260.c @@ -79,6 +79,9 @@ #include "readfile.h" +/* Make preferences read-only, use versioning_userdef.c. */ +#define U (*((const UserDef *)&U)) + static void do_versions_nodetree_image_default_alpha_output(bNodeTree *ntree) { bNode *node; diff --git a/source/blender/blenloader/intern/versioning_270.c b/source/blender/blenloader/intern/versioning_270.c index 8a8a5ade476..fb570b956b6 100644 --- a/source/blender/blenloader/intern/versioning_270.c +++ b/source/blender/blenloader/intern/versioning_270.c @@ -81,6 +81,9 @@ #include "MEM_guardedalloc.h" +/* Make preferences read-only, use versioning_userdef.c. */ +#define U (*((const UserDef *)&U)) + /* ************************************************** */ /* GP Palettes API (Deprecated) */ diff --git a/source/blender/blenloader/intern/versioning_280.c b/source/blender/blenloader/intern/versioning_280.c index 58a9f22c4bd..8a3ec61bbc8 100644 --- a/source/blender/blenloader/intern/versioning_280.c +++ b/source/blender/blenloader/intern/versioning_280.c @@ -96,6 +96,9 @@ #include "MEM_guardedalloc.h" +/* Make preferences read-only, use versioning_userdef.c. */ +#define U (*((const UserDef *)&U)) + static bScreen *screen_parent_find(const bScreen *screen) { /* Can avoid lookup if screen state isn't maximized/full diff --git a/source/blender/blenloader/intern/versioning_defaults.c b/source/blender/blenloader/intern/versioning_defaults.c index 45ec6eef813..f2d6db886d3 100644 --- a/source/blender/blenloader/intern/versioning_defaults.c +++ b/source/blender/blenloader/intern/versioning_defaults.c @@ -56,6 +56,9 @@ #include "BLO_readfile.h" +/* Make preferences read-only, use versioning_userdef.c. */ +#define U (*((const UserDef *)&U)) + /** * Rename if the ID doesn't exist. */ diff --git a/source/blender/blenloader/intern/versioning_legacy.c b/source/blender/blenloader/intern/versioning_legacy.c index 1b30c7371a2..5d46f0735eb 100644 --- a/source/blender/blenloader/intern/versioning_legacy.c +++ b/source/blender/blenloader/intern/versioning_legacy.c @@ -89,6 +89,9 @@ #include <errno.h> +/* Make preferences read-only, use versioning_userdef.c. */ +#define U (*((const UserDef *)&U)) + static void vcol_to_fcol(Mesh *me) { MFace *mface; diff --git a/source/blender/blenloader/intern/writefile.c b/source/blender/blenloader/intern/writefile.c index 3390d30ad5d..b3a16b1fb4d 100644 --- a/source/blender/blenloader/intern/writefile.c +++ b/source/blender/blenloader/intern/writefile.c @@ -181,6 +181,9 @@ #include <errno.h> +/* Make preferences read-only. */ +#define U (*((const UserDef *)&U)) + /* ********* my write, buffered writing with minimum size chunks ************ */ /* Use optimal allocation since blocks of this size are kept in memory for undo. */ |